Hong Kong grants first cross-border data access to 10 AI, biotech firms in Northern Metropolis

Hong Kong Chief Executive John Lee announced a pilot scheme granting about 10 AI and biotech companies early cross-border data access in the Northern Metropolis tech hub, ahead of ~100 other firms. This marks a concrete step in facilitating data flows between Hong Kong and mainland China, though details on data categories and security protocols remain unclear. The move signals Hong Kong's push to attract tech firms by easing data restrictions, potentially boosting its competitiveness as a regional tech hub.
